SFA (18-3, 9-1) vs. Sam Houston (15-6, 8-2)

WHEN: FEB 1 (SAT) 5:30 P.M.
WHERE: Bernard G. Johnson Coliseum (Huntsville, TX)
WATCH: ESPN3

Now this isn't the Jason "Whata" Hooten team from last year that beat us by 22. (Could have been 50 but their hands got tired from all the high fives.) The Delaney brothers are gone. This is Kai Mitchell's (6'7" Sr F) team now. They play guard heavy with a lot of three shots. The distribute well, steal well, and force turnovers. Bottom line, they score. They are tied with the Jacks with a scoring average of 80.9 points per game.
They regularly play 11 men, and they all score. They do foul a lot, but their depth keeps them in games. They will not be an easy out.

It's defense that will win. The Jacks are in the unenviable position of the third worst in the nation at turning the ball over. However, we have forced more than 100 more turnovers the we have committed, but it's not enough to get 10 fast breaks in this game. We need to be locked down. We know we're getting the full Comeaux, but we need Bain, Kevon, Roti, and our bigs to play like nothing gets to go in that hoop. They did excellent against ACU with firm defense and a few fouls. The game plan will be the same as it has through the last two weeks: work the inside, deny the lane, force the point guard the wrong way, get in all the passing lanes, and don't foul too much.

Sam does have a little height, but it's mostly on the bench. Their three tallest players get a combined 24 minutes per game, so Ryan is spot on, this team is very guard heavy.
Kensmil's defense will be key on Mitchell and the Jacks ability to close out the three point arc is critical.
On offense, we should be able to attack the rim all day and have an advantage on the boards. I believe they will try to take Kevon away by doubling him, so expect to see plenty of Cam. We should be able to get the ball to Kensmil in the post as well. Kensmil struggles against taller centers, but that won't be an issue against Sam.
If this becomes a battle of free throws, we will lose. Sam shoots better than 75% from the line and went 22-26 against Corpus.

Odds have improved for Sam according to ESPN, who have the Kats a 53% favorite.

Statistically we are very similar. A big difference comes in schedules. Sam has played 6 of their first 10 at home, we will make it 7 of 11. Sam has defended their home court this year, as they are undefeated at home (Not hard when you look at who they have played: Paul Quinn, LeTourneau, Randall University, Louisiana Tech, Wiley, Northwestern State, New Orleans, Nicholls, SLU, ACU, A&MCC).

Kai Mitchell is the man, but not the only one. Zach Nutall is averaging 14.1 ppg and has proven to be a good scorer. They also have a couple of others that average just under 10 ppg. This team is good. They had Mississippi State behind the woodshed before an epic collapse. Of their six losses, only one is by double digits.

Offensively they are like us. They can be red hot where the goal opens up, and they can go ice cold from the field. They charged out to a big lead on Corpus, and quickly saw that lead evaporate. The key to winning is simple: Control the boards, guard the perimeter, limit turnovers. Hooten wants to be the best, and he took our formula and has run with it. He is going try to do to us, what we will try to do to him. We have to be better. Either we come out flat, or we come out focused and put our foot on their throats early.
